Subject: Handover — GiftNote receipt mailer release

Hi Priya,

Handing over the GiftNote donation-receipt mailer for this cycle. Build 3.2 is staged; templates passed rendering checks and the tax-line fix is included. Deploy window is Thursday morning. The mailer artifacts must be signed before the push job will accept them. The deploy key you'll need is included below.

signing key of bagap-yawep = bky13_TbfT6ZMUoGJo2

**Franchise Agreement Overview — Manager Access Only**

This page summarizes the pending franchise agreement between Ostermill Kitchens and the Halbrook Group. Term is seven years, covering three territories, with renewal contingent on quarterly quality audits. Royalty structure follows our standard tiered model, though Halbrook negotiated a reduced marketing levy in year one. The incoming director should review Section 9 carefully before signing. One confidential item follows.

management briefing: Project Ulavan slips by two quarters because of the staffing delay.

Subject: Handover — Tilegrove cache layer release

Hi Maren,

Taking over from me this cycle: the Tilegrove tile-rendering cache layer is staged for 4.2. The eviction fix landed Tuesday and soak tests on the Harkwell cluster look clean. Remaining items: bump the manifest version, confirm CDN purge hooks, and re-sign the release bundle since the old cert expired Friday. Rollback plan is documented in the runbook under "cache-layer-4.2". The deploy key you'll need to sign with is below.

deploy key for kajof-fajop: bky6_gDHw9Q

Subject: TilePath prefetcher rollout

Hi all — the new map-tile prefetcher in TilePath is live on staging as of this morning. It fetches adjacent zoom levels when the viewport idles, cutting pan latency by roughly 30%. New folks: check the onboarding doc before touching cache settings. The build this was verified against is below.

pipeline stamp: htk9_ce63042d9